Funeral service for Alton Rayburn Prince, 74, of Cullman will be at 11 a.m., Saturday, December 3rd, 2016 at Cullman Funeral Home Chapel, Rev. Albert Dean Estes officiating with interment in Duck Creek Cemetery.

Cullman Funeral Home is in charge of the arrangements.

Mr. Prince passed away Wednesday, November 30th, at his residence. He was born September 23, 1942 to Lelan and Edith Chambers Prince.

He was preceded in death by his parents; his brothers, Howard Prince and Harold Prince.

Survivors include his wife of 52 years, Connie Leathers Prince; son, Steven Prince; daughter, Laura (Tim) Hesterley; brothers, Joe (Lulabell) Prince, Freddie (Linda) Prince, Tony (Betty) Prince; sisters, Carolyn (Jimmie) Rodgers, Kathryn (Robert) Wilkins; sister-in-law, Geraldine Prince; grandchildren, Maria (David) Landers, Michelle (Alan) Brock, Derrick (Brittany) Prince, Felicia (Dalton) Phillips, Mackenzie Hesterley, Makayla Hesterley; great-grandchildren, Brian Calloway, John Curtis Landers, James Greyson Landers, Evelyn Phillips, Alexis Brock and a host of family and friends.

Visitation will be Friday evening at the funeral home from 5:30 – 8 p.m.
